Typewriter for Kids: Mistakes to Avoid Before Making Your Choice

Between vintage models found at flea markets and toy typewriters sold in supermarkets, the quality of manufacturing and the level of safety vary greatly. Before giving a typewriter to a child, several technical criteria deserve careful analysis, as purchasing mistakes often focus on a few recurring points.

Child’s Typewriter: Comparison of Criteria Between Toy Model and Functional Machine

The first confusion lies in the very nature of the object. A plastic toy typewriter and a functional typewriter (new or restored) do not meet the same manufacturing constraints, nor do they serve the same educational purposes.

Criterion Toy Typewriter Functional Machine (Portable)
Main Material Plastic, sometimes fragile Metal (steel, aluminum)
Weight Light, easy to move Heavier, increased stability
Print Quality Often poor, misaligned letters Clear if the ribbon is in good condition
Ribbon Availability Proprietary ribbons, hard to find Universal ribbons, still manufactured
Pinch Points Rare (simplified mechanism) Carriage, levers, cover to check
Toy Safety Standards (EN71) Applicable if sold as a toy Not applicable (functional object)
Durability Several months of regular use Several decades if maintained

This table highlights a paradox: the toy typewriter reassures with its lightness but disappoints with its print quality. In contrast, a portable functional typewriter offers a clear result but requires prior inspection of the mechanisms for use by a child.

Safety and Pinch Points: What Toy Standards Do Not Cover

European standards EN71 regulate toys sold to children: screwed battery compartments, absence of sharp edges, shock resistance. A functional typewriter sold at a flea market or on a private website falls outside this regulatory framework.

The moving carriage, line return levers, and metal cover create pinch zones that must be systematically inspected before entrusting the machine to a child. On a portable model from the 1960s or 1970s, a child’s fingers can get caught between the carriage and the frame during a sudden line return.

  • Check that the carriage slides without excessive resistance and that the return lever does not snap violently
  • Inspect the edges of the cover and the bottom plate for any untrimmed metal edges
  • Test each key to ensure that no rod remains stuck in the up position, which would force the child to pull on it

On a toy typewriter, these risks are lower because the mechanism is simplified. However, the too-soft strike of a toy model prevents the child from feeling the mechanical resistance, which reduces the educational interest of the exercise.

Ribbons and Paper: The Overlooked Consumables in Choosing a Typewriter

The most costly mistake in the long run concerns consumables. A model with a proprietary or hard-to-find ink ribbon becomes unusable within a few weeks of regular use.

Functional machines from historical brands (Olivetti, Hermes, Brother) generally use universal ribbons that are still manufactured today. Replacement remains simple and inexpensive. In contrast, some toy typewriters incorporate specific cartridges that the manufacturer stops producing after a few years.

What Paper to Use with a Child’s Typewriter

The weight of the paper directly influences the readability of the typed text. Paper that is too thin tears under the strike, especially if the child presses hard. A sufficiently dense weight absorbs ink without smudging and withstands the repeated passage of the carriage.

Opting for standard office-type paper rather than low-cost printer paper avoids most problems of jamming and tearing. This detail may seem trivial, but it conditions the child’s daily experience with the machine.

Left-Handed Child and Typewriter: A Constraint Rarely Anticipated

Buying guides for children’s typewriters almost systematically overlook the question of laterality. Recent recommendations on handwriting for left-handed children show that wrist position, support tilt, and strike angle influence fatigue and motivation.

On a typewriter, the carriage return lever is located on the left. A left-handed child must therefore perform the return gesture with their dominant hand, which interrupts their typing more naturally than for a right-handed person. The left-side carriage return benefits left-handers in this specific regard.

However, the position of the paper guide and access to the ink ribbon are designed for right-handers on most portable models. This means that maintenance manipulations (changing the ribbon, adjusting the paper) may be less intuitive for a left-handed child without assistance.

Age and Key Resistance: Adapting the Machine to the Child’s Strength

The mechanical resistance of the keys varies considerably from one model to another. An office machine from the 1950s requires firm pressure that most children under eight cannot maintain over time. More recent portable models offer a softer touch.

Testing the typing with the child before purchase remains the only reliable way to assess compatibility. A key that is too hard tires the fingers in a few minutes and turns the writing exercise into a chore. A key that is too soft, typical of low-end toy models, does not produce a readable impression.

  • For a child aged six to eight, a lightweight portable model with a soft keyboard is better suited than an office machine
  • Beyond ten years, most functional portable machines can be used without difficulty
  • Before six years, fine motor skills are rarely sufficient for regular typing, regardless of the model

Ultimately, choosing a typewriter for a child relies on three concrete checks: the availability of ink ribbons, the absence of pinch points in the mechanism, and the key resistance suited to the child’s hand strength. Cross-referencing these three criteria before purchase makes the difference between a machine used daily and an object abandoned after a few days.
